BMW Recalling 368,000 Vehicles

BMW is recalling 368,000 5 Series and 6 Series vehicles from the 2003-10 model years because of a potential problem with the car battery, according to Reuters. In some of the vehicles, the electrical system may malfunction because the battery cable cover was incorrectly mounted, BMW told Reuters. As a result, the vehicle may not start or a fire may be ignited, BMW said. Less than 1% of the vehicles tested exhibited the issue, BMW says. BMW says it's not aware of any injuries resulting from the defect. The carmaker will repair the cable free of charge, and the repair should take about 30 minutes to complete, Reuters says.
